Transaction b66fa6a426b160995ac275db261dc35834e0a8df87580ef50ad62931ba7ba1f0
1 Input
1 Output
-
b66fa6a426b160995ac275db261dc35834e0a8df87580ef50ad62931ba7ba1f0:0
- value
- 2804982
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 008fafb4ff14c0766df8ff5faf8138d2fcd07ef6 OP_EQUAL
- address
- 31jz43fYuLhzhHHzdP8pbXpd1YpYwqU6tA